Applications Now Open for September 2024 at Music Leaders Network – The Music Leaders Network, a women’s leadership program, is now accepting applications for its September 2024 intake.
Running from September 2024 to January 2025, the program, led by Remi Harris MBE and Tamara Gal-On, seeks to empower women in the music industry with five to 25 years of experience.
The initiative, boasting a cohort of 12 members, contributes to a growing alumnae network of 70 women across various sectors within the music industry.
Designed to transform the career trajectories of mid-career women, including those who identify as non-binary or trans, the program emphasizes professional development. Alumnae hail from diverse backgrounds, with representation from entities like Fuga, Polydor, September Management, PPL, PRS for Music, AIM Ireland, and Blue Raincoat Music, alongside freelance music creators.
Tamara Gal-On emphasizes the program’s positive impact on the industry, noting the participants’ subsequent roles as mentors and leaders, creating a ripple effect.
Applications for the September 2024 intake are open until May 31, offering aspiring leaders an opportunity to join a supportive peer-to-peer network and receive the necessary skills to thrive in a male-dominated industry. The Music Leaders Network aims to foster lasting connections among participants, nurturing a community of support throughout their careers.
Katie Eckett, Manager of Business and Legal at Merlin, emphasized the invaluable connections forged through the Music Leaders Network program. Reflecting on her experience, she highlighted the network of remarkable women and the multitude of opportunities that have arisen as a result.
The camaraderie among participants, she noted, has fostered mutual support and served as a significant source of encouragement throughout their journeys.
Janeace (Jay-T) Thompson, Director of Talent, Culture & Experience at PRS for Music, shared insights into the organization’s approach to talent development. Acknowledging the program’s success and the career advancements achieved by previous participants, PRS for Music proactively identified high-potential women leaders to nominate for the Music Leaders Network.
With Elaine Allen, Head of Joint Ventures and Revenue Assurance at PRS for Music, being the organization’s first participant, there is genuine optimism that the program will yield positive outcomes for her and future leaders alike.
According to a survey conducted post-programme, an overwhelming 91% of participants reported increased confidence in their leadership abilities. Furthermore, the survey revealed an average income increase of 66% within one year post-programme among respondents, underscoring the program’s tangible impact on career progression.

To ensure accessibility, the founders of the Music Leaders Network will once again offer discretionary bursaries to assist self-employed participants and those working for charities with program costs.
For individuals contemplating enrollment in the program, Online Q&A events are scheduled for Thursday, March 14 at 11:45 am, Thursday, April 18 at 1 pm, and Tuesday, May 14.
These sessions provide prospective participants and businesses with the opportunity to pose inquiries about the program, offering valuable insights and clarification. Pre-registration on Eventbrite is required for attendance, and each session lasts for 30 minutes.
